Chennai (Tamil Nadu) [India], August 12: AFCOM Holdings Limited (AFCOM), (BSE – 544224) is an integrated air cargo solutions company with operations across domestic and international routes. The Company has announced its Unaudited Financial Results for Q1 FY26.
Key Financial Highlights
* Total Income of ₹ 11,889.0 Lakhs, YoY growth of 198.1%
* EBITDA of ₹ 3,664.7 Lakhs, YoY growth of 2,401.8%
* Net Profit of ₹ 2,707.0 Lakhs, YoY growth of 4,255.5%
* EPS of ₹ 10.9, YoY growth of 3,102.9%

Q1 FY26 Key Business Highlights
Joins IATA Clearing House
* Accepted as a member of IATA Clearing House.
* Endorsed for creditworthiness and operational credibility.
* Gains free credit access with 330+ airlines and 230+ suppliers.
* Enables interline, block space, and code-share agreements.
* Access to global suppliers with faster, 15-day payment cycles.
* Standardized invoicing and guaranteed settlements improve efficiency.
* Supports global cargo movement via Afcom airway bill.
